Both Port Everglades and The Port of Miami have been closed, until further notice, due to the threat of Hurricane Frances.

Ships due to arrive Saturday and Sunday may be delayed, since they cannot return to this area until all danger is past.

UPDATE:

alt text

Governor Bush (Yeah, THAT one!) has dclared a "State of Emergency for the entire State of Florida.

The main runways at Miami International and Ft. Lauderdale Int'l Airports have been closed....

Schools in South Florida closed today.

A "Mandatory Evacuation" has been ordered for the coastal areas of Miami-Dade County (Miami), Broward County (Ft. Lauderdale), Palm Beach County (Lake Worth), and up the coast to Jacksonville.

I just got this off Carnivals Website for all of you sailing to the Panama Canal on the Paradise...........hope it helps...good luck and stay safe......

PARADISE – Fifteen-day Panama Canal cruise scheduled to depart Sun., Sept. 5 has been converted to a fourteen-day Panama Canal voyage departing on Mon., Sept. 6. The only anticipated itinerary adjustment is the deletion of a port call to Aruba. Guests will receive a $200 per person shipboard credit. Those who wish to cancel may choose between a future cruise credit or a full refund.

For guests who booked air on their own and elect to sail on the modified itinerary for any of the above voyages, Carnival will provide up to $100 per person in reimbursement for costs incurred as a result of necessary flight changes. Guests will be required to provide proper documentation. Guests who elect to cancel their voyage and booked air on their own, will not be provided reimbursement of airfare-related costs.

All of the ships listed above are expected to arrive late from their current voyages due to port closures.
